Poem: An Image

What power does an image posses . . . . . . . .?
 
Can it reach through flesh to reach the mortal soul of man . . . . . . . .?

Can an image enrage and confound the passions . . . . . . . ?

The repugnant can titillate and inflame

Enchantment can turn to burden

Horror and Beauty both can provoke the spirit

What power does an image posses . . . . . . . ?

The power to build or destroy.

The power to love or to hate.

The power of life and of death.
